What it is, How it works

Utilizing hair testing has emerged as an effective means of identifying drug and alcohol consumption. Hair acts as a prolonged record of alcohol and drug use, encapsulating biomarkers within the fibers of the hair's natural growth. When obtained from near the scalp, hair can reveal a detection timeframe stretching up to around three months for alcohol and drugs. Collecting hair is straightforward, somewhat challenging to tamper with, and easy to transport.

A sample measuring 1.5 inches and comprising roughly 200 hair strands (approximately the thickness of a #2 pencil) nearest the scalp yields 100mg of hair, which is the recommended quantity for both screening and confirmation. For EtG, additional tests, and tests exceeding 10 panels, a specimen weighing 150mg is advised. We suggest using a jeweler’s scale to weigh the specimen. If scalp hair cannot be sourced, an equivalent volume of body hair may be gathered. References to head hair pertain to scalp hair exclusively, whereas body hair encompasses other varieties of hair (such as facial, axillary, etc.).

Process Overview

The core procedures in processing a drug test result within a laboratory include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.

During Accessioning, the preliminary handling of a sample within a laboratory's system takes place. This stage ensures the sample is properly sealed and dispatched, allocates a random L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and fills in any data entry gaps not addressed by an electronic chain of custody system.

Screening denotes an initial, swift assessment for illicit substances. Although Screening presents a cost-efficient method to rule out drug usage in most samples, a positive screen must be corroborated for it to be valid in legal proceedings. All samples exhibiting a positive indication in Screening demand subsequential confirmation.

For a sample testing presumptively positive during the Screening phase, additional hair is extracted from the original specimen and readied for Extraction. During Extraction, drugs are withdrawn from hair at significantly reduced concentrations compared with other methods (like urine or oral fluid), making hair drug screening the most challenging method to conduct.

Validated positive screening outcomes are confirmed via G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S methodologies. Any presumptively positive samples undergo cleansing prior to confirmation as necessary. The comprehensive laboratory process, from Accessioning through Confirmation, is examined under both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and meeting ISO / IEC 17025 accreditation standards.

Pros of hair drug testing:

  • Extended detection timeframe: Hair drug tests can identify drug use over a span of approximately 90 days, whereas urine tests possess a shorter detection duration.
  • Hard to manipulate: Manipulating a hair drug test is extremely difficult, thus ensuring more reliable results.
  • Historical analysis: It can illustrate a sequence of drug usage over a particular timeframe, rather than just recent intake.

Drawbacks:

  • Incapable of detecting recent intake: Detection of drugs in hair requires about 5-7 days.
  • Higher cost: Hair drug tests are typically pricier compared with alternative drug testing approaches.
  • Result variability: Hair color and individual growth variations can influence the drug metabolite concentration within the hair.

Note: While frequently termed as "hair follicle tests", these tests examine the hair strand instead of the follicle beneath the scalp
